Cara menggunakan fungsi len pada python

Mengembalikan panjang berisi jumlah karakter dalam string atau jumlah byte yang diperlukan untuk menyimpan variabel.

Sintaks

Len ( string | VarName)

Sintaks fungsi Len memiliki argumen ini:

Argumen

Deskripsi

string

ekspresi stringyang valid. Jika string mengandung Null, Null dikembalikan.

varName

Nama variabel yang valid. Jika VarName berisi null, Null dikembalikan. Jika VarName adalah varian, Len memperlakukannya sama seperti string dan selalu mengembalikan jumlah karakter yang ada di dalamnya.

Keterangan

Satu (dan hanya satu) dari dua argumen yang mungkin harus ditentukan. Dengan tipe yang ditentukan pengguna, Len mengembalikan ukuran yang akan ditulis ke file tersebut.

Catatan:  Gunakan fungsi Lenb dengan data byte yang terdapat dalam string, seperti dalam bahasa kumpulan karakter bita ganda (DBCS). Sebagai ganti mengembalikan jumlah karakter dalam string, maka Lenb mengembalikan jumlah byte yang digunakan untuk mewakili string tersebut. Dengan tipe yang ditentukan pengguna, Lenb mengembalikan ukuran dalam memori, termasuk padding di antara elemen. Untuk kode contoh yang menggunakan Lenb, lihat contoh kedua dalam topik contoh.

Catatan:  Len mungkin tidak dapat menentukan jumlah aktual byte penyimpanan yang diperlukan saat digunakan dengan string panjang variabel dalam tipe data yang ditentukan pengguna.

Contoh kueri

Ekspresi

Hasil

Pilih ProductID, Len (ProductID) sebagai ProductLen dari ProductSales;

Mengembalikan nilai dari bidang "ProductID" dan panjang nilai tersebut dalam kolom ProductLen.

Contoh VBA

Catatan: Contoh yang mengikuti demonstrasi penggunaan fungsi ini dalam modul Visual Basic for Applications (VBA). Untuk informasi selengkapnya tentang bekerja dengan VBA, pilih Referensi Pengembang di daftar turun bawah di samping Cari dan masukkan satu istilah atau lebih di kotak pencarian.

Contoh pertama menggunakan Len untuk mengembalikan jumlah karakter dalam string atau jumlah byte yang diperlukan untuk menyimpan variabel. Tipe... Blok tipe akhir mendefinisikan CustomerRecord harus diawali dengan kata kunci privat jika muncul dalam modul kelas. Dalam modul standar, pernyataan tipe bisa bersifat publik.

________0

Contoh kedua menggunakan Lenb dan fungsi yang ditentukan pengguna (lenmbcs) untuk mengembalikan jumlah karakter BYTE dalam string jika ANSI digunakan untuk mewakili string.

len() merupakan fungsi built-in yang disediakan oleh Python untuk menghitung panjang suatu list. Mari kita lihat bagaimana penggunaan fungsi len() pada contoh dibawah ini.

Contoh mengetahui panjang list

Cara menggunakan fungsi len pada python

Berdasarkan contoh diatas dapat dilihat bagwa denhan menggunakan fungsi len(data) didapatkan panjang list data yaitu 6. Penggunaan fungsi ini sangat penting nantinya ketika Anda membuat program yang lebih kompleks yng melibatkan list di dalamnya.

Iklan

Bagikan ini:

  • Twitter
  • Facebook

Menyukai ini:

Suka Memuat...

List dapat diidentifikasi melalui kurung kotak yang melingkupinya, dan nilai-nilai individu dipisahkan dengan koma.

Untuk mendapatkan panjang sebuah list di Python, kamu bisa menggunakan fungsi built-in len().

Selain menggunakan fungsi len(), kamu juga dapat menggunakan for loop dan fungsi length_hint() untuk mendapatkan panjang list.

Di dalam artikel ini, Aku akan menunjukkan bagaimana mendapatkan panjang list melalui 3 cara yang berbeda.

Cara Mendapatkan Panjang List di Python dengan For Loop

Kamu bisa menggunakan for loop di Python untuk mendapatkan panjang list karena seperti tuple dan dictionary, list bersifat iterable.

Metode ini umum disebut dengan metode naïve.

Contoh di bawah menunjukkan cara menggunakan metode naïve untuk mendapatkan panjang list di Python

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22]

# Inisialisasi variabel counter
counter = 0

for item in demoList:
    # Tambahkan variabel counter untuk mendapatkan setiap item di dalam list
    counter = counter + 1

    # Print hasil ke console dengan mengonversi counter ke string untuk mendapatkan angkanya
print("The length of the list using the naive method is: " + str(counter))
# Output: The length of the list using the naive method is: 7

Cara Mendapatkan Panjang List Menggunakan Fungsi len()

Fungsi len() merupakan cara yang paling umum untuk mendapatkan panjang sebuah iterable.

Cara ini merupakan cara yang lebih sederhana dibandingkan menggunakan for loop.

Sintaks untuk menggunakan metode len() adalah len(namaList).

Cuplikan code menunjukkan cara menggunakan fungsi len() untuk mendapatkan panjang list:

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22]

sizeOfDemoList = len(demoList)

print("The length of the list using the len() method is: " + str(sizeOfDemoList))
# Output: The length of the list using the len() method is: 7 

Cara Mendapatkan Panjang List Menggunakan Fungsi length_hint()

Metode length_hint() merupakan cara yang kurang dikenal dalam mendapatkan panjang list dan iterable lainnya.

length_hint() didefinisikan di dalam modul operator, sehingga kamu perlu import dari sana sebelum bisa digunakan.

Sintaks untuk menggunakan metode length_hint() adalah

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22]

sizeOfDemoList = len(demoList)

print("The length of the list using the len() method is: " + str(sizeOfDemoList))
# Output: The length of the list using the len() method is: 7 
5.

Contoh di bawah ini menunjukkan metode length_hint() untuk mendapatkan panjang list:

from operator import length_hint

demoList = ["Python", 1, "JavaScript", True, "HTML", "CSS", 22]

sizeOfDemoList = length_hint(demoList)
print("The length of the list using the length_hint() method is: " + str(sizeOfDemoList))
# The length of the list using the length_hint() method is: 7

Komentar Akhir

Artikel ini menunjukkan bagaimana mendapatkan ukuran sebuah list melalui 3 metode: for loop, fungsi len(), dan fungsi length_hint() dari modul operator.

Kamu mungkin bertanya-tanya, cara mana yang sebaiknya digunakan dari 3 metode ini.

Aku menyarankan untuk menggunakan len() karena kamu tidak perlu melakukan banyak hal untuk menggunakannya dibandingkan for loop dan length_hint().

Sebagai tambahan, len() sepertinya lebih cepat dibandingkan for loop dan length_hint().

Jika kamu merasa artikel ini membantu, bagikan artikel ini supaya dapat mencapai orang lain yang membutuhkan.

ADVERTISEMENT

ADVERTISEMENT

ADVERTISEMENT


Cara menggunakan fungsi len pada python
Author: Kolade Chris (English)

Web developer and technical writer focusing on frontend technologies.

Cara menggunakan fungsi len pada python
Translator: Ihsan

Read more posts.


If you read this far, tweet to the author to show them you care. Tweet a thanks

Learn to code for free. freeCodeCamp's open source curriculum has helped more than 40,000 people get jobs as developers. Get started

LEN () Python untuk apa?

Kita masuk dalam pembahasan yang pertama yaitu fungsi Len(). Fungsi len() digunakan untuk mengidentifikasi dan mengetahui seberapa panjang jumlah item atau anggota pada suatu objek. Penerapan fungsi len() ini bisa dipraktekkan pada berbagai jenis data seperti data sequence dan data collection.

Apa fungsi append pada Python?

Append. Salah satu fitur dalam array python yang cukup sering digunakan adalah fungsi append. Fungsi append ini berguna untuk menambahkan nilai array pada urutan terakhir. Fungsi ini sedikit berbeda dengan fungsi insert, dimana fungsi insert bisa menambahkan nilai array pada posisi tertentu.

Apa itu range pada Python?

Fungsi Range di Python Fungsi range() memberikan bilangan-bilangan yang berurutan sesuai denagn argumen yang diberikan. Informasi lebih lengkap bisa diliaht di dokumentasi Python. Argumen start adalah bilangan pertama yang diinginkan.

Apa itu print di Python?

Apa Itu Fungsi Print? Fungsi print pada python adalah sebuah fungsi yang digunakan untuk memunculkan output yang ingin kita print pada console. Fungsi print terlihat sangat simple namun ternyata print merupakan fungsi yang paling banyak digunakan dalam sintaks python.